UPDATE - I managed to go and see the movie today, and I give it 3 out of 5 stars. The movie is essentially the game on the big screen, and I often saw scenes very similar to what I normally saw playing the game. The movie loses the game’s reliance on the main character being a clone, instead he’s an orphan trained to kill from an early age. This makes me wonder why he and all of his fellow assassins are still bald with a computer bar codes tattooed on the back of their heads. It made sense in the game when he was one of hundreds of clones who all look alike, but it doesn’t make sense when he’s one of just a bunch of multi-ethnic trained killers. There’s plenty of cutting and shooting, and he performs his job with no regard for mercy - the perfect hitman. The one soft spot he shows is for a hooker with a heart he’s forced to pair up with. But even then, he doesn’t know what to do with her when she’s throwing her nubile young self at him. I guess they don’t teach the birds and the bees in assassin school. Overall, a good action film and it satisfied the gamer in me.
